| forum.bitel.ru http://forum.bitel.ru/  | 
|
| Как узнать тарифный план пользователя http://forum.bitel.ru/viewtopic.php?f=1&t=1450  | 
	Страница 1 из 1 | 
| Автор: | lelick [ 12 сен 2008, 14:45 ] | 
| Заголовок сообщения: | Как узнать тарифный план пользователя | 
Ребята как узнать тарифный план пользователя. В базе он лежит закодированый. Как можно его от туда вытащить в нормальном виде чтоб в дальнейшем использовать для других нужд.  | 
	|
| Автор: | dimOn [ 12 сен 2008, 18:17 ] | 
| Заголовок сообщения: | |
Каким образом он закодирован? Тарифный план привязан к договору через contract_tariff, по ИД в таблице tariff_plan есть название. А какой вид нормальный?  | 
	|
| Автор: | Администратор [ 15 сен 2008, 11:38 ] | 
| Заголовок сообщения: | |
Полагаю, вопрос в том, можно ли вытащить прайс из забитого тарифа. Значения из mtree_node вытащить можно, они там не шифрованы. Просто закодированы в пары ключ-значение и сохранены в текстовое поле. Вот только оформить это в читаемый прайс будет не очень легко, тарифное дерево ориентировано на тарификацию, а не на визуализацию прайса для клиента..  | 
	|
| Автор: | lelick [ 16 сен 2008, 18:57 ] | 
| Заголовок сообщения: | |
Я немного неправильно сформулировал вопрос, сорри. Необходимо сделать следущее: надо получить баланс пользователя и его тарифный план, после чего сравнить их. Так вот возможно ли сделать запрос в базу со сторонней программы для получения данных по состоянию баланса пользователя и его тарифному плану(сумму). Необходима сумма тарифного плана.  | 
	|
| Автор: | Администратор [ 17 сен 2008, 14:35 ] | 
| Заголовок сообщения: | |
Чтобы получить сумму из тарифа - нужно вытащить узел из mtree_node. Код записи можете узнать, выбрав узел в тарифе и нажав Ctrl+I. Ну а баланс из contract_balance, см. http://dbinfo.bitel.ru  | 
	|
| Страница 1 из 1 | Часовой пояс: UTC + 5 часов [ Летнее время ] | 
| Powered by phpBB® Forum Software © phpBB Group http://www.phpbb.com/  | 
|